Базовый курс для пользователей базы данных MySQL, базы данных Oracle версии 19c и ниже. Курс знакомит слушателей с концепцией реляционной базы данных и языком SQL, помогает оценить преимущества этого мощного языка программирования. Используется графическая среда SQL Developer. Демонстрации и практические упражнения позволят закрепить слушателям полученные знания.
Категория Слушателей: все категории пользователей БД Oracle и БД MySQL
Предварительная подготовка: Представление о концепциях и методиках обработки данных
Программа:
- Знакомство с продуктами компании Oracle
- Основные концепции реляционных и объектно-реляционных баз данных
- Выборка данных - команда SELECT
- Ограничение строк и сортировка данных
- Однострочные функции
- Функции преобразования
- Группировка данных и использование групповых функций
- Выборка данных из нескольких таблиц
- Подзапросы
- Операции UNION, UNION ALL, INTERSECT, MINUS
- Управление транзакциями
- Манипулирование данными – команды DML в Oracle
- Манипулирование данными – команды DML в MySQL
- Команды DDL в Oracle
- Команды DDL в MySQL
- Словарь базы данных, представления словаря базы данных
- Другие объекты базы данных — последовательности, представления, индексы, синонимы
- Управление объектами схемы
- Использование скалярных подзапросов
- Связанные подзапросы
- Использование выражения WITH
- Манипулирование большими наборами данных
- Управление пользовательским доступом
- Реализация сложных подзапросов
- Работа с данными в разных временных зонах